Sunny and dry weekend – 10/19/18

Today: It’s going to be simply gorgeous out there today! While out times it could be slightly breezy, winds shouldn’t ruin the day by any stretch. Today will be remembered as sunny, borderline warm and dry. Highs will be in the 60s and 70s in the lower elevations with the 50s for the local mountains. Surface high pressure will keep things tranquil. Enjoy the quiet weather!

Tonight: Clear skies are expected overnight with lows down to the 30s and 40s. Grab the jacket as you step outdoors late tonight and early Saturday!

Extended: High pressure continues to dominate this upcoming weekend. Highs will be even warmer Saturday and Sunday and will be accompanied by pure sunshine. Into Monday morning, a weak cold front moves through. This will shave off temperatures by a few degrees, but nothing drastic. Tuesday and Wednesday, cooler air works its way into the area. Upsloping winds combined with a low pressure system will spark some showers, increase moisture in the area and cool us down. Precipitation will primarily fall in the form of rain on Tuesday and Wednesday in the lower elevations; right now, it appears as if it will be too warm for snow. However, some snow is possible over the high country. Stick with us for the latest!
